- 🏫 A post-graduate software developer currently working at a startup Cabswale.
- 👨💻 Currently working on enhancing my algorithmic thinking and skills
- 🌱 Learning more about Open Source
I have a deep passion for writing code, constantly yearning to expand my knowledge. My journey began as a web developer and later shifted towards software development. Through my experiences, I have discovered the fascinating potential of modern technologies harnessed by the human mind when provided with the right opportunities.
I thoroughly enjoy engaging in discussions about emerging technologies, and I hold the belief that understanding core concepts allows one to adapt to any programming language with ease, given some basic information.
Looking ahead, I am eager to explore career opportunities within communities that align with my skills, enabling me to make a positive impact. Additionally, I am excited to dive deeper into the realm of Open Source and contribute to projects that promote accessibility for all sections of society. It is essential to me that these endeavors are undertaken sustainably, with a commitment to minimize harm to the environment.
- Senior Software Developer (12/2024 - Present)
- App for connecting drivers and customers. My primary role is back-end development and logical thinking.
- Developed and improved an end-to-end algorithm for customer ride searching and appropriate driver suggestions.
- Created a system for drivers to connect with each other, enabling community development.
- Improved api security.
- Worked on creating an analytical system to measure system stats and activity, leading to better business related decision making.
- Google Play Store App Link
- Full-Stack Software Developer (07/2022 - 11/2024)
- Worked as lead developer on multiple projects.
- Created apps and websites for clients according to their requirements.
- Learnt more about Ionic and mobile-app development.
- Web Development Intern (03/2022 - 06/2022)
- Worked on creating new features for the existing systems at the firm.
- Fixed bugs in the websites delivered to the clients.
- Learnt new Angular features & RxJS.
- HTML, CSS, JavaScript, Node.js, TypeScript, Angular, Firebase
- Ignite Retail is a platform for retail organizations to expand their business operations and do employee training. Once the organizations are onboarded, their employees can enroll in courses, view their statistics and keep track of their progress.
- With multiple big organizations being involved, the scale of this project was the huge and learning how to handle projects of such scale was a great learning for me.
- My role included handling the logics and back-end.
- Ignite Retail Website Link
- HTML, CSS, JavaScript, TypeScript, Angular
- SmartPills is a multi-platform system that connects users to pharmacists. I worked as a Full-Stack Developer for this system working on the core features of the website and admin panel.
- Users can generate coupons on the website and then avail them at their nearest pharmacists. Pharmacists can manage their inventory using the Admin Panel.
- Admin Panel Link
- Website Link
- HTML, CSS, JavaScript, Ionic, TypeScript, Angular
- Thread is a mobile application that connects manufacturers, weavers and sizers in the fabric industry.
- I worked as a Full-Stack Developer for this app, handling the logics. The app enables all the parties involved in the process of textile manufacturing process to connect with each other. They can post their requirements and have price negotiations, contract creations according to their needs. They can follow up on the complete job process and progress.
- HTML, CSS, JavaScript, Ionic, TypeScript, Angular
- Makruzz is a simple ferry-booking mobile application that enables tourists and commuter in the Andaman & Nicobar area to book ferries. I developed the core functionalities for this application.
- Google Play Store Application Link
- Java
- Developed a command-line tool that works as a repository manager and helps in version controlling of software.
- Gitlet is just like Git (excluding some features like Git contains support for remote repositories while Gitlet does not, it is a single source version control system).
- Source Code
- HTML, CSS, JavaScript
- Developed the old classic Pig Game with a modern UI.
- Two players roll a dice turn by turn, the first player out of these two whose total reaches 100 wins the game. A player can pig out if they roll a 1.
- Game
- Python, HTML
- Worked on the back-end for this game.
- Game-play involved the user deploying ants to protect their queen from attacking bees.
- Source Code & Game
- Python, HTML
- Developed back-end for a speed typing test.
- It can also be played as a multiplayer game. Mis-typed words are auto-corrected.
- Source Code & Website
- HTML, CSS, JavaScript
- Theme Switcher as the name says is a theme switcher based on the front-end.
- There are two choices for themes: Light or Dark, with options to solarize or normalize both of them.
- Website
- HTML, CSS
- Developed front-end for a dummy website as part of a CSS course.
- Website
- HTML, CSS
- Developed a website to promote a dummy tours and travels program.
- Website
- HTML, CSS
- Developed a website for promoting a non-existent hotel.
- Website
- HTML, CSS, JavaScript
- Developed and maintained a website for a Cricket game for LG.
- Website